‘Pizza Put’ returning to the Children’s Museum of Wilmington

WILMINGTON, NC (WWAY) — The Children’s Museum of Wilmington is hosting Pizza Putt in early February and the community is invited.
Attendees can expect unlimited pizza, mini-golf, and beer. There will also be the Team Spirit competition, Mug Master Challenge and raffles.
Then event is from 6 to 9 p.m. on February 6 for those 21 and up.
“Pizza Putt is a night of fun for our community, but it’s also a celebration of the power of play,” says Patti Erkes, Director of Development at the Museum. “Play is important at every age, and every putt, every slice, and every cheer helps support hands-on learning experiences for our very youngest children and the families we serve across Wilmington.”
Tickets are $50 per person and include unlimited pizza, beer from 15 Wilmington breweries, and mini-golf for the entire event.
